• 技术文章 >web前端 >js教程

    javascript为什么没有权限

    藏色散人藏色散人2021-06-18 11:17:29原创245

    javascript没有权限的原因:1、由于逻辑错误,比如先关闭了iframe,然后又要调用主页面当中的函数;2、因为子页面跨域了,需要仔细检查一下iframe的src地址。

    本文操作环境:windows7系统、javascript1.8.5版、Dell G3电脑。

    javascript为什么没有权限?

    javascript出现运行时错误:没有权限的原因:

    原因有两个:

    1. 是逻辑错误,比如先关闭了iframe然后又要调用主页面当中的函数。

    2. 子页面跨域了,仔细检查一下iframe的src地址。

    JavaScript错误

    Error 对象在错误发生时提供了错误的提示信息。

    以下实例中 try 语句块包含了未定义的函数 "adddlert" ,执行它会产生错误,catch 语句块会输出该错误的信息:

    <!DOCTYPE html>
    <html>
    <head>
    <meta charset="utf-8">
    <title>HTML中文网</title>
    </head>
    <body>
    <h2>JavaScript Error 对象</h2>
    <p>以下实例中 try 语句块包含了未定义的函数 "adddlert" ,执行它会产生错误,catch 语句块会输出该错误的信息。</p>
    <p id="demo" style="color:red"></p>
    <script>
    try {
        adddlert("Welcome guest!");
    }
    catch(err) {
        document.getElementById("demo").innerHTML = 
        err.name + "<br>" + err.message;
    }
    </script>
    </body>
    </html>

    运行结果:

    28d373d5be17cc3ae14a8db1d2bb0c9.png

    推荐学习:《javascript高级教程

    以上就是javascript为什么没有权限的详细内容,更多请关注php中文网其它相关文章!

    声明:本文原创发布php中文网,转载请注明出处,感谢您的尊重!如有疑问,请联系admin@php.cn处理
    专题推荐:javascript
    上一篇:javascript怎么比较大小 下一篇:javascript中求和的方法
    大前端线上培训班

    相关文章推荐

    • javascript字符串怎么进行编码转换• javascript的引入方式有哪三种• JavaScript中数组怎么求和• JavaScript怎么让数组倒序• javascript怎么比较大小

    全部评论我要评论

  • 取消发布评论发送
  • 1/1

    PHP中文网